Post duck and goose fried fingerlings.
cut your breast into finger sized slices. soak in your marinade overnight. or not, they still good with out marinade. take your favorite shore lunch and prepare your strips in the shore lunch. make sure your grease is good and hot. put a drop of water in the grease and of she pops and crackles real fierce its ready. drop your shore lunch prepared strips in for a few minutes a batch. thats it. trust me they are good. one of the best ways to cook up alot of bird. one of those recipes that is still really good the next morning cold before the next hunt or in a baggy for lunch while hunting.
